2GXB
Crystal Structure of The Za Domain bound to Z-RNA
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| APS BEAMLINE 19-ID |
| Synchrotron site | APS |
| Beamline | 19-ID |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2005-10-21 |
| Detector | ADSC QUANTUM 315 |
| Wavelength(s) | 0.97 |
| Spacegroup name | C 2 2 21 |
| Unit cell lengths | 73.603, 92.776, 50.229 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 25.000 - 2.250 |
| R-factor | 0.19908 |
| Rwork | 0.194 |
| R-free | 0.24392 |
| Structure solution method | MOLECULAR REPLACEMENT |
| Starting model (for MR) | : 1QBJ |
| RMSD bond length | 0.007 |
| RMSD bond angle | 1.198 |
| Data scaling software | SCALA |
| Phasing software | EPMR |
| Refinement software | REFMAC (5.2.0005) |
Data quality characteristics
| Overall | Outer shell | |
| Low resolution limit [Å] | 25.000 | 2.308 |
| High resolution limit [Å] | 2.250 | 2.250 |
| Number of reflections | 7511 | |
| Completeness [%] | 90.7 | 92.5 |
| Redundancy | 5.1 | 5.1 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 3.6 | 292 | 40% PEG600, 100mM Sodium Acetate, pH 3.6, VAPOR DIFFUSION, HANGING DROP, temperature 292K |
